Luxoft is a global leader in high-end software development.
Luxoft is looking for talents with a passion for technology & ready to create original solutions. Once on board, you are invited to expand your knowledge & skills, offering you a continuous learning experience helping you stretch your potential.
So if you’re enthusiastic by the idea of accessing cutting edge technology & innovation to make an impact, why don't you join us?
Person hired for this role will be expected to become SME FX and will be involved in full life cycle of the product – from defining requirements together with the business, through implementation and testing, to production support.
Beside BOW tasks for SOR FX, it is scheduled for migration to global strategic platform - SOR+ which will be main focus in the future.
- Design and hands-on development of enhancement to the system (C++/Linux/Shell/Perl/Python/Lua)
- Creating Technical/Support Documentation
- 3rd line production support and issue investigation follow-up.
- Participation in technical architecture discussions and decisions
- Regular Interaction with other Credit-Suisse up/downstream systems
- UAT/QA System Support and issue investigation
- Participation in the entire software development life cycle including technical design, documentation, software development, unit testing & production implementation
- Post production software maintenance and bug fixes
- Understanding and helping to shape client's requirements
- Contributing to planning end-to-end development of applications from technical specifications and design documents.
- Performing successful unit, performance, system, integration and acceptance testing
- Applying standard development and change management methodologies
- Collaboration with globally distributed team
- Integration with strategic customer technology platforms.
Essential
5+ years front-office IT system development experience in C++ /Linux
In-depth knowledge of C++ (on Linux platform) including STL and Boost (5+ Years of overall experience)
Strong experience in real-time programming (multi-threading, OS IPC/synchronization mechanisms, communications/sockets)
Strong communication and team leadership skills
Excellent problem solving skills
Degree in Computer Science or equivalent
Desirable
Low-latency development experience and skills
Informatica UM product experience
TIBCO EMS/RT SmartSockets experience
Knowledge of ORACLE/SQL, Linux scripting languages (e.g. Perl) is desirable
Previous financial services experience
Experience and good understanding of FIX messaging
Smart Order Router (SOR) is the Customer IT strategic Smart Order Routing solution for accessing various liquidity pools to offer best execution for our clients. Spanning two areas of asset classes, it executes default and customized strategies to trade across 50+ distinct exchanges, ECN’s and liquidity pools. SOR forms a core part of the Alternative Execution Products (AEP) suite of electronic trading systems and integrates with a number of other keys systems across the whole customer business.
